j***a语言结构语句讲解,j***a语言基本结构

kodinid 7 0

大家好,今天小编关注到一个比较意思的话题,就是关于java语言结构语句讲解的问题,于是小编就整理了4个相关介绍Java语言结构语句讲解的解答,让我们一起看看吧。

  1. 在java中switch结构中必须有default语句吗?
  2. 什么是java程序中基本的结构单位?
  3. switch语法结构?
  4. 在java语言里如何在子类中调用父类的有参构造函数?

在j***a中switch结构中必须有default语句吗?

不是必须的。 switch case 语句是一个条件选择语句,找到相同的case值做为入口,执行后面的程序;若所有的case都不满足,则找default入口;若未找到则退出整个switch语句。 所以default只是一个备用的入口,有没有都无所谓。

是j***a程序中基本的结构单位

j***a程序以类为基本模块,是面向对象编程语言,面向对象就是把所有要解决的问题抽象然后将抽象出的成员函数封装到一起就构成一个类,所有的事情都放到类里面去做,这种编程模式更符合人类的做事习惯。

java语言结构语句讲解,java语言基本结构-第1张图片-安济编程网
图片来源网络,侵删)

而c语言是过程性语言,它的结构主要以函数块为主,函数间通过互相调用实现一些功能,是面向过程的语言。

switch语法结构?

switch的语法结构是编程中一种常用的分支结构,主要用于根据某个变量的值来执行不同代码块。在Python、J***a、C++等编程语言中,switch结构类似于以下形式:

1.首先,使用switch关键字声明一个switch结构。

java语言结构语句讲解,java语言基本结构-第2张图片-安济编程网
(图片来源网络,侵删)

2.紧跟一个括号,里面是一个整数字符串等可变类型变量。

3.使用大括号{}包含多个case分支,每个case分支后面都有一个冒号。

4.每个case分支内部包含一个或多个代码块,这些代码块是根据变量值执行的。

java语言结构语句讲解,java语言基本结构-第3张图片-安济编程网
(图片来源网络,侵删)

5.可以选择性地添加一个default分支,用于处理无法匹配到任何case的情况。

switch语句是一种选择结构,它根据表达式的值从多个选项中选择一个执行。

switch语句的语法结构如下:

scss

复制

switch(expression) {

   case constant1:

      // 执行语句

      break;

在j***a语言里如何子类中调用父类的有参构造函数?

如果你是想在子类的构造函数中调用父类构造函数,则需要在子类的构造函数的函数体第一行注释语句除外)使用:super(参数列表)的方式调用,该参数列表与父类有参构造函数声明的参数列表一致,如果你不是在子类构造函数中调用,则无法直接调用父类构造函数,这时创建一个父类对象(通过你想调用的有参父类构造函数创建),就间接调用了该构造函数。

到此,以上就是小编对于j***a语言结构语句讲解的问题就介绍到这了,希望介绍关于j***a语言结构语句讲解的4点解答对大家有用。

标签: 结构 函数 语句